#7293f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7293f1 is composed of 44.7% red, 57.6%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.7% cyan, 39%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 224.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 69.6%. #7293f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#0027e3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#7293f1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7293f1 has RGB values of R:114, G:147,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7508977.

Hex triplet 7293f1 #7293f1
RGB Decimal 114, 147, 241 rgb(114,147,241)
RGB Percent 44.7, 57.6, 94.5 rgb(44.7%,57.6%,94.5%)
CMYK 53, 39, 0, 5
HSL 224.4°, 81.9, 69.6 hsl(224.4,81.9%,69.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 224.4°, 52.7, 94.5
Web Safe 6699ff #6699ff
CIE-LAB 62.333, 14.652, -50.819
XYZ 33.247, 30.794, 87.406
xyY 0.22, 0.203, 30.794
CIE-LCH 62.333, 52.889, 286.083
CIE-LUV 62.333, -18.03, -82.983
Hunter-Lab 55.492, 9.832, -54.543
Binary 01110010, 10010011, 11110001

Shades and Tints of #7293f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ff3fd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#7293f1 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#949494 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8d94a7 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7699f2 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#659cf0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#5ca6b2 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7496f1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#6a99f0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#649fc9 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
